Abuse of the Pardoning Power. Gov. Oates has pardoned Alonzo Edwards, of Elmore County, who was convicted of white-capping and sentenced to ten years in the penitentiary. No convict should be pardoned unless for excellent reasons. A man pardoned by Gov. Jones was recently engeaged in murderout assault upon two aged ladied for the purpose of robbery; an this only one instance of the many in which executive clmency has been abused.– Tuskegee News.
